Video: Ի՞նչ է NoSQL բաշխված տվյալների բազաները:
2024 Հեղինակ: Lynn Donovan | [email protected]. Վերջին փոփոխված: 2023-12-15 23:48
NoSQL ոչ հարաբերական DMS է, որը չի պահանջում ֆիքսված սխեմա, խուսափում է միացումներից և հեշտ է մասշտաբավորվել: Օգտագործման նպատակը ա NoSQL տվյալների բազա համար է բաշխված տվյալների պահեստներ՝ տվյալների պահպանման հսկայական կարիքներով: NoSQL տվյալների բազա նշանակում է «Ոչ միայն SQL» կամ «Not SQL»: Թեև ավելի լավ տերմին կլիներ NoREL NoSQL բռնել է.
Նաև ի՞նչ է NoSQL տվյալների բազայի օրինակը:
Փաստաթղթերի վրա հիմնված տվյալների բազա պահպանում է պիտակավորված տարրերից կազմված փաստաթղթեր: Օրինակներ MongoDB, CouchDB, OrientDB և RavenDB: Յուրաքանչյուր պահեստային բլոկ պարունակում է տվյալներ միայն մեկ սյունակից, Օրինակներ BigTable, Cassandra, Hbase և Hypertable: Գրաֆիկի վրա հիմնված տվյալների բազա ցանց է տվյալների բազա որն օգտագործում է հանգույցներ տվյալների ներկայացման և պահպանման համար:
Երկրորդ, ինչի՞ համար է լավ NoSQL տվյալների բազան: NoSQL տվյալների բազաներ նախատեսված են հատուկ տվյալների մոդելների համար և ունեն ճկուն սխեմաներ՝ ժամանակակից հավելվածներ կառուցելու համար: NoSQL տվյալների բազաներ լայնորեն ճանաչված են իրենց զարգացման հեշտությամբ, ֆունկցիոնալությամբ և մասշտաբով կատարողականությամբ: Նրանք օգտագործում են տվյալների մի շարք մոդելներ, ներառյալ փաստաթուղթը, գրաֆիկը և բանալի-արժեքը:
Հետագայում հարցն այն է, թե ինչ է նշանակում NoSQL տվյալների բազա:
Ա NoSQL (ի սկզբանե նկատի ունենալով «ոչ SQL» կամ «ոչ հարաբերական») տվյալների բազա ապահովում է տվյալների պահպանման և որոնման մեխանիզմ, որը է մոդելավորվել է նշանակում է բացի հարաբերականում օգտագործվող աղյուսակային հարաբերություններից տվյալների բազաներ . NoSQL տվյալների բազաներն են ավելի ու ավելի է օգտագործվում մեծ տվյալների և իրական ժամանակի վեբ հավելվածներում:
Որո՞նք են NoSQL տվյալների բազաների տարբեր տեսակները:
Կան չորս մեծ NoSQL տեսակները : բանալի-արժեքի պահեստ, փաստաթղթերի պահեստ, սյունակային տվյալների բազա , և գրաֆիկ տվյալների բազա . Յուրաքանչյուրը տիպ լուծում է մի խնդիր, որը հնարավոր չէ լուծել հարաբերությունների միջոցով տվյալների բազաներ . Փաստացի իրականացումները հաճախ դրանց համակցություններ են: OrientDB-ն, օրինակ, բազմամոդել է տվյալների բազա , համատեղելով NoSQL տեսակները.
Խորհուրդ ենք տալիս:
Ի՞նչ է հարաբերական տվյալների բազաները DBMS-ում:
Հարաբերական տվյալների բազան պաշտոնապես նկարագրված աղյուսակների մի շարք է, որոնցից տվյալները կարող են մուտք գործել կամ հավաքվել տարբեր ձևերով՝ առանց տվյալների բազայի աղյուսակները վերակազմավորելու: Հարաբերական տվյալների բազայի ստանդարտ օգտագործողի և կիրառական ծրագրավորման ինտերֆեյսը (API) Կառուցված հարցման լեզուն (SQL) է:
Ինչպե՞ս միաձուլել sqlite տվյալների բազաները:
Կրկնակի սեղմեք յուրաքանչյուր այժմ բեռնված db ֆայլ՝ բոլորը բացելու/ակտիվացնելու/ընդլայնելու համար: Զվարճալի մաս. պարզապես աջ սեղմեք աղյուսակներից յուրաքանչյուրի վրա և կտտացրեք Պատճենել, այնուհետև գնացեք թիրախային տվյալների բազա բեռնված տվյալների բազայի ֆայլերի ցանկում (կամ ստեղծեք նորը, եթե անհրաժեշտ է) և աջ սեղմեք թիրախ db-ի վրա և սեղմեք վրա Paste
Որտե՞ղ են օգտագործվում հարաբերական տվյալների բազաները:
Հարաբերական տվյալների բազաները օգտագործում են աղյուսակներ՝ տեղեկատվություն պահելու համար: Ստանդարտ դաշտերը և գրառումները ներկայացված են աղյուսակում որպես սյունակներ (դաշտեր) և տողեր (գրառումներ): Հարաբերական տվյալների բազայի միջոցով դուք կարող եք արագ համեմատել տեղեկատվությունը սյունակներում տվյալների դասավորվածության պատճառով
Ինչպե՞ս եք որոնում հետազոտական տվյալների բազաները:
Որոնման լավագույն տասը խորհուրդներ Օգտագործեք AND-ը` հիմնաբառերն ու արտահայտությունները համատեղելու համար ամսագրերի հոդվածների էլեկտրոնային տվյալների շտեմարաններում որոնելիս: Օգտագործեք կրճատում (աստղանիշ) և գծագրեր (սովորաբար հարցական կամ բացականչական նշան): Պարզեք, արդյոք ձեր օգտագործած տվյալների բազան ունի «առարկայական որոնման» տարբերակ: Օգտագործեք ձեր երևակայությունը
Որոնք են SQL տվյալների բազաները:
SQL (արտասանվում է 'ess-que-el') նշանակում է Structured Query Language: SQL հայտարարություններն օգտագործվում են այնպիսի առաջադրանքներ կատարելու համար, ինչպիսիք են տվյալների բազայում տվյալների թարմացումը կամ տվյալների բազայից տվյալներ ստանալու համար: Հարաբերական տվյալների բազայի կառավարման որոշ սովորական համակարգեր, որոնք օգտագործում են SQL, հետևյալն են՝ Oracle, Sybase, Microsoft SQL Server, Access, Ingres և այլն: